'Caps fall to Seattle in the final minutes

SEATTLE, WA – Vancouver Whitecaps FC fell 1-0 to Seattle Sounders FC on a late goal at CenturyLink Field on Saturday night.

Kelvin Leerdam scored the winner in the sixth minute of added time after a relentless effort by the ‘Caps.

Playing the last game in a three-match, eight-day stretch head coach Marc Dos Santos shook things up with a 4-4-2 diamond formation, bringing Jake Nerwinski and Victor ‘PC’ Giro in as the two changes from Wednesday's 2-2 draw in Dallas.

The ‘Caps looked like they might get a repeat of Yordy Reyna’s Goal of the Week, when the striker won a free kick from thirty-yards out in the last minutes of the first half.
